Tennis legend, Roger Federer has often proved he is one of sport’s Mr Nice Guys, and the Swiss superstar reinforced that this week by paying a surprise visit to the players of PSG… moments after they had inflicted a last-gasp defeat upon his team Basel.
Federer was watching from the stands as the French giants faced Basel in a Champions League Group A clash at St Jakob Park.
PSG emerged victorious courtesy of a 90th minute Thomas Meunier goal, breaking the hearts of the Swiss swiss league leaders.
But despite watching his native team come agonisingly close but leaving with nothing, Federer still found time to head down to the dressing room to surprise the stars of PSG.
Federer, unarguably one of tennis’s all time greats, posed for a picture along with PSG captain Thiago Silva, Marco Verratti, Lucas Moura and Marquinhos.
The players, suited and booted following their Champions League heroics, were all smiles as they posed with Federer.
The 35-year-old is still using his time to prepare for his tennis comeback after not stepping onto a court since his Wimbledon semi-final defeat to Milos Raonic back in July.
